Understanding AI and Its Impact on Productivity

Artificial Intelligence, a subset of computer science, focuses on creating systems that can perform tasks requiring human intelligence, such as learning, reasoning, and problem-solving. AI technologies, including machine learning, natural language processing, and predictive analytics, have significantly impacted various sectors, from healthcare to finance. In the context of productivity, AI offers powerful tools that automate routine tasks, provide insights through data analysis, and enhance decision-making processes.

One of the most significant contributions of AI to productivity is automation. Repetitive and time-consuming tasks can be automated, freeing up human resources to focus on more strategic and creative work. For instance, AI-driven tools can manage schedules, prioritize tasks, and even predict potential bottlenecks in project timelines. This not only saves time but also reduces the likelihood of human error, leading to more efficient and reliable outcomes.

Cryptocurrency: A New Paradigm for Digital Transactions

Cryptocurrency, a digital or virtual currency that uses cryptography for security, has emerged as a revolutionary force in the financial world. Unlike traditional currencies, cryptocurrencies operate on decentralized blockchain networks, ensuring transparency, security, and immutability. This technology has the potential to transform how we conduct transactions, manage assets, and even rethink traditional economic models.

The adoption of cryptocurrency extends beyond financial transactions. It offers a new way to represent value and ownership in digital ecosystems. Smart contracts, self-executing contracts with the terms directly written into code, leverage blockchain technology to automate and enforce agreements without intermediaries. This not only streamlines processes but also reduces costs and increases trust among parties involved.

Merging AI and Cryptocurrency: A Powerful Synergy

The true potential of AI and cryptocurrency is realized when these technologies are combined. The integration of AI into cryptocurrency systems can enhance security, optimize transactions, and create more intelligent and responsive digital assets. For example, AI can be used to analyze market trends, predict price movements, and automate trading strategies, making cryptocurrency investments more accessible and efficient for a broader audience.

Moreover, AI can improve the scalability and interoperability of blockchain networks. By optimizing consensus mechanisms and enhancing data processing capabilities, AI can help blockchain systems handle higher transaction volumes and reduce latency. This is crucial for applications that require real-time processing, such as supply chain management and decentralized finance (DeFi) platforms.

Challenges and Considerations

While the potential of AI and cryptocurrency in enhancing productivity is vast, there are several challenges and considerations to keep in mind. One of the primary concerns is the regulatory landscape. The intersection of AI and cryptocurrency operates in a relatively uncharted territory, and regulatory frameworks are still evolving. Users and developers must stay informed about legal requirements and ensure compliance to avoid potential issues.

Another challenge is the technical complexity involved in integrating AI with blockchain technologies. Developing robust and secure systems requires expertise in both domains, which can be a barrier for some organizations. However, as the technology matures and more tools become available, these challenges are likely to diminish.
